Siddharth College of Law is located in Mumbai, India. Siddharth College of Law is a prestigious law college that was founded by Dr. Babasaheb Ambedkar in 1956. Dr. Babasaheb Ambedkar was the chief architect of Indian Constitution and a social reformer. Siddharth College of Law is affiliated with University of Mumbai and is approved by the Bar Council of India. Siddharth College of Law courses are in the discipline of Law like, LLB, LLM, and PG Diploma Courses. Siddharth College of Law Admission is based on MH-CET-LAW entrance exam, which is conducted by the state government. The aim of Siddharth College of Law is to provide legal education to students from any sections of the society. .
Siddharth College of Law has a good infrastructure and is equipped by a library, a moot court hall, cafeteria and sports complex. Siddharth College of Law alumni list is very good as they have been able to produce illustrious lawyers and judges who have contributed to the society like - Justice P.B. Sawant, Justice S.M. Daud, Justice R.A. Jahagirdar, Justice V.R. Krishna Iyer, and Justice B.G. Kolse Patil.

For Siddharth College of Law admission in LL.B, candidate is required to clear LAW-CET of Maharashtra.
Steps for applying for LAW-CET of Maharashtra:
Visit Maharashtra govt. State Common Entrance Test official website.
Select Apply online option.
Fill in the registration form and click on the registration tab.
You will receive a provisional registration number and password.
Login using the provisional registration number and password, and complete the form.
Upload your photograph and signature to the website.
Review your information and confirm it.
Pay the fees of Application online.
